DEMAT is a
large multi-academy Trust which consists of 39 primary academies and approximately
7,000 pupils. Our primary focus as a Trust is to ensure that every child in our
schools receives a world-class education through a knowledge-rich curriculum which
values the arts as well as what may be perceived as more academic subjects. We
are unapologetic about holding the highest expectations for our children, for
their outcomes as well as their behaviour and personal development. DEMATs
vision is to; To learn. To know. To lead out. This sets out what we do as a Trust and
how we work with our children to become confident within society and to develop
as individuals. This is encapsulated in
the DEMAT Promise and underpinned by our values of Love, Community,
Trust, Respect and Ambition. To find out more about the Trust,
